What is Liposuction? What is it?
Liposuction is a cosmetic procedure to get
rid of small areas of unwanted body fat. Lipo is performed on
areas of the body that are susceptible to fat deposit build-up, such as the
stomach, hips, hips and arms.
How is liposuction done? May
Be A Common, And Understandable, Question. Liposuction Can Be
Performed Under General Anaesthetic or Under Local Anaesthetic with Sedation. A
small incision is made around the area to be treated by your surgeon. Then, a
thin plastic tube called a cannula is inserted. The Cannula is attached
to a strong vacuum device that removes the fat quickly and efficiently.

Who Should Get Liposuction?
Ideal Liposuction Candidates Are At or Just
Below Their Target Weight. However, they have Discreet Resistant Fat Deposits
that aren't able to resist a diet and exercise program. Liposuction
Should Not Be Considered As A Weight Loss Operation. The Aspirated Fat Weight
Is Very Small Compared To The Total Weight. Clothes will fit better
if you target specific fat deposits. This can help to give the appearance of
serious weight loss.

Liposuction Recovery Times
Although swelling, bruising and soreness to
the world are normal after liposuction surgery, this can disappear within one
to two weeks. But,
the complete results of the surgery are often not seen until six weeks after
surgery. Then, when the world returns to normal, incisions have fully healed. The
incisions are so small that any scarring will be minimal and can fade quickly
over time, leaving you with smooth skin within the treated area. Doctor
will advise you once you can resume normal daily activity and exercise, but
normally, you'll be asked to take one to two weeks off work to recover. To
protect the treated area, you will need to wear a post-surgery support garment.
